| // An enum representing the value type of a TensorboardTimeSeries. |
| type TensorboardTimeSeries_ValueType int32 |
| |
| const ( |
| // The value type is unspecified. |
| TensorboardTimeSeries_VALUE_TYPE_UNSPECIFIED TensorboardTimeSeries_ValueType = 0 |
| // Used for TensorboardTimeSeries that is a list of scalars. |
| // E.g. accuracy of a model over epochs/time. |
| TensorboardTimeSeries_SCALAR TensorboardTimeSeries_ValueType = 1 |
| // Used for TensorboardTimeSeries that is a list of tensors. |
| // E.g. histograms of weights of layer in a model over epoch/time. |
| TensorboardTimeSeries_TENSOR TensorboardTimeSeries_ValueType = 2 |
| // Used for TensorboardTimeSeries that is a list of blob sequences. |
| // E.g. set of sample images with labels over epochs/time. |
| TensorboardTimeSeries_BLOB_SEQUENCE TensorboardTimeSeries_ValueType = 3 |
| ) |

| // TensorboardTimeSeries maps to times series produced in training runs |
| type TensorboardTimeSeries struct { |
| state protoimpl.MessageState |
| sizeCache protoimpl.SizeCache |
| unknownFields protoimpl.UnknownFields |
| |
| // Output only. Name of the TensorboardTimeSeries. |
| Name string `protobuf:"bytes,1,opt,name=name,proto3" json:"name,omitempty"` |
| // Required. User provided name of this TensorboardTimeSeries. |
| // This value should be unique among all TensorboardTimeSeries resources |
| // belonging to the same TensorboardRun resource (parent resource). |
| DisplayName string `protobuf:"bytes,2,opt,name=display_name,json=displayName,proto3" json:"display_name,omitempty"` |
| // Description of this TensorboardTimeSeries. |
| Description string `protobuf:"bytes,3,opt,name=description,proto3" json:"description,omitempty"` |
| // Required. Immutable. Type of TensorboardTimeSeries value. |
| ValueType TensorboardTimeSeries_ValueType `protobuf:"varint,4,opt,name=value_type,json=valueType,proto3,enum=google.cloud.aiplatform.v1beta1.TensorboardTimeSeries_ValueType" json:"value_type,omitempty"` |
| // Output only. Timestamp when this TensorboardTimeSeries was created. |
| CreateTime *timestamppb.Timestamp `protobuf:"bytes,5,opt,name=create_time,json=createTime,proto3" json:"create_time,omitempty"` |
| // Output only. Timestamp when this TensorboardTimeSeries was last updated. |
| UpdateTime *timestamppb.Timestamp `protobuf:"bytes,6,opt,name=update_time,json=updateTime,proto3" json:"update_time,omitempty"` |
| // Used to perform a consistent read-modify-write updates. If not set, a blind |
| // "overwrite" update happens. |
| Etag string `protobuf:"bytes,7,opt,name=etag,proto3" json:"etag,omitempty"` |
| // Immutable. Name of the plugin this time series pertain to. Such as Scalar, |
| // Tensor, Blob |
| PluginName string `protobuf:"bytes,8,opt,name=plugin_name,json=pluginName,proto3" json:"plugin_name,omitempty"` |
| // Data of the current plugin, with the size limited to 65KB. |
| PluginData []byte `protobuf:"bytes,9,opt,name=plugin_data,json=pluginData,proto3" json:"plugin_data,omitempty"` |
| // Output only. Scalar, Tensor, or Blob metadata for this |
| // TensorboardTimeSeries. |
| Metadata *TensorboardTimeSeries_Metadata `protobuf:"bytes,10,opt,name=metadata,proto3" json:"metadata,omitempty"` |
| } |

| // Describes metadata for a TensorboardTimeSeries. |
| type TensorboardTimeSeries_Metadata struct { |
| state protoimpl.MessageState |
| sizeCache protoimpl.SizeCache |
| unknownFields protoimpl.UnknownFields |
| |
| // Output only. Max step index of all data points within a |
| // TensorboardTimeSeries. |
| MaxStep int64 `protobuf:"varint,1,opt,name=max_step,json=maxStep,proto3" json:"max_step,omitempty"` |
| // Output only. Max wall clock timestamp of all data points within a |
| // TensorboardTimeSeries. |
| MaxWallTime *timestamppb.Timestamp `protobuf:"bytes,2,opt,name=max_wall_time,json=maxWallTime,proto3" json:"max_wall_time,omitempty"` |
| // Output only. The largest blob sequence length (number of blobs) of all |
| // data points in this time series, if its ValueType is BLOB_SEQUENCE. |
| MaxBlobSequenceLength int64 `protobuf:"varint,3,opt,name=max_blob_sequence_length,json=maxBlobSequenceLength,proto3" json:"max_blob_sequence_length,omitempty"` |
| } |
